#import "MQTTMessage.h"
@implementation MQTTMessage
+ (id)connectMessageWithClientId:(NSString*)clientId
userName:(NSString*)userName
password:(NSString*)password
keepAlive:(NSInteger)keepAlive
cleanSession:(BOOL)cleanSessionFlag {
MQTTMessage* msg;
UInt8 flags = 0x00;
if (cleanSessionFlag) {
flags |= 0x02;
}
if ([userName length] > 0) {
flags |= 0x80;
if ([password length] > 0) {
flags |= 0x40;
}
}
NSMutableData* data = [NSMutableData data];
[data appendMQTTString:@"MQIsdp"];
[data appendByte:3];
[data appendByte:flags];
[data appendUInt16BigEndian:keepAlive];
[data appendMQTTString:clientId];
if ([userName length] > 0) {
[data appendMQTTString:userName];
if ([password length] > 0) {
[data appendMQTTString:password];
}
}
msg = [[MQTTMessage alloc] initWithType:MQTTConnect data:data];
return msg;
}
+ (id)connectMessageWithClientId:(NSString*)clientId
userName:(NSString*)userName
password:(NSString*)password
keepAlive:(NSInteger)keepAlive
cleanSession:(BOOL)cleanSessionFlag
willTopic:(NSString*)willTopic
willMsg:(NSData*)willMsg
willQoS:(UInt8)willQoS
willRetain:(BOOL)willRetainFlag {
UInt8 flags = 0x04 | (willQoS << 4 & 0x18);
if (willRetainFlag) {
flags |= 0x20;
}
if (cleanSessionFlag) {
flags |= 0x02;
}
if ([userName length] > 0) {
flags |= 0x80;
if ([password length] > 0) {
flags |= 0x40;
}
}
NSMutableData* data = [NSMutableData data];
[data appendMQTTString:@"MQIsdp"];
[data appendByte:3];
[data appendByte:flags];
[data appendUInt16BigEndian:keepAlive];
[data appendMQTTString:clientId];
[data appendMQTTString:willTopic];
[data appendUInt16BigEndian:[willMsg length]];
[data appendData:willMsg];
if ([userName length] > 0) {
[data appendMQTTString:userName];
if ([password length] > 0) {
[data appendMQTTString:password];
}
}
MQTTMessage *msg = [[MQTTMessage alloc] initWithType:MQTTConnect
data:data];
return msg;
}
